    Over the next month or so we plan to start rolling out a new version of the MHS system. When the MHS system was originally designed almost a decade ago most hilts where 1.5" OD and needed to be in order to fit the electronics. Things have come a long way since then and now hilts can be much smaller thanks to sound modules like the NB and Li-ion batteries. We plan to first offer double female sections along with a male/female adapter to go from v2 to v1 so that the smaller sections can be used as grips, etc. The MHSv2 will not be a replacement for the MHSv1 and will sell along side it.

    Here are a few of the basic design changes..

    1.3" OD x 1" ID (the hilt sections will be made from 1.5" OD stock allowing us to offer designs with well defined features).
    Threading will change to .275" male/.4" female and with a finer thread pitch (less rotations needed and the female threaded portion becomes shorter allowing for better designs).
    Square cut o-ring instead of a c-clip for the MPS inserts (much easier to install and works surprisingly well).
    Smaller version but the same basic setup for the LED module.
    Overall it is just a smaller version of the MHS with a few key design changes.

    Things are moving along on these. We should have a few of the double female sections and some V1 male to V2 female adapters done for the may 4th sale.

    It will be awhile before the V2 system has anywhere near the parts the V1 system currently has. We have to put keeping current parts in stock the main priority and add these as time permits.

    When these become available you will notice that the double female sections on the V2 are a bit more expensive than the V1 which is due to material cost. We start with the same OD material as the V1 on the V2 but the V2 has a much smaller ID which means more material overall = higher cost. The other parts such as pommels and blade holders will probably be a little cheaper than V1. Also we have not had much of a price increase if any in the last 9 years on MHS parts.

    I had sent a prototype MHSV2 hilt to Rob at Genesis Custom Sabers for feedback and he decided to make a saber out of it. The design was just to show the amount the MHSV2 can be grooved and raised in areas from the base 1.3" OD. The grooves go in to about 1.15" while the raised area go out to 1.45".
